Secondary fracture rates and risk factors 1 year after a proximal femoral fracture under FLS.

Hotaka IshizuTomohiro ShimizuShu YamazakiYusuke OhashiKomei SatoShun ShimodanNorimasa Iwasaki
Published in: Journal of bone and mineral metabolism (2023)
During the COVID-19 pandemic, secondary fractures can be prevented if the patients can be followed and osteoporosis treatment can be continued. Conversely, despite adequate osteoporosis drug examination and treatment, a certain number of secondary fractures still occurred. The finding that postoperative osteoporosis therapy using routine medications and rehabilitation is associated with secondary fractures may support the importance of establishing clinical standards consisting of a multidisciplinary collaboration for FLS.
